logo

Hive数据库端口与连接方式:安全与高效的数据处理

作者:公子世无双2023.12.22 12:06浏览量:13

简介:Hive数据库端口与连接方式

Hive数据库端口与连接方式
在大数据处理和分析领域,Hive数据库扮演着重要的角色。它为数据仓库提供了一个简单的数据查询接口,并且能够以一种可靠、高效且可扩展的方式处理大规模的数据。要成功地使用Hive,了解其数据库端口和连接方式是至关重要的。
首先,我们来探讨Hive数据库的端口。Hive使用的是基于TCP/IP的协议,因此它需要一个网络端口来与其他系统进行通信。默认情况下,Hive使用的端口号是10000。这个端口通常在Hive的配置文件hive-site.xml中定义。你可以根据需要修改这个端口号,但请注意,任何修改都需要重启Hive服务才能生效。
接下来,让我们看看如何连接Hive数据库。Hive提供了多种连接方式,以满足不同客户端和环境的需求。以下是几种常见的连接方式:

  1. JDBC连接:Java Database Connectivity (JDBC) 是Java应用程序连接数据库的标准方法。你可以使用JDBC驱动程序来连接Hive,然后执行SQL查询。对于使用Java编写的应用程序,这是一种非常方便的连接方式。
  2. Beeline连接:Beeline是Hive提供的一个命令行工具,用于直接与Hive数据库进行交互。它支持各种命令行选项和功能,使得管理和查询数据变得非常简单。
  3. HiveServer2连接:HiveServer2是Hive的服务器模式,它允许远程客户端通过TCP/IP网络连接到Hive。使用HiveServer2,你可以从不同的客户端(如浏览器或应用程序)连接到Hive,并执行查询和操作数据库。
  4. ODBC连接:对于不使用Java的应用程序,你可以使用ODBC(Open Database Connectivity)来连接Hive。ODBC是一种通用的数据库连接方式,支持多种编程语言和平台。
    无论你选择哪种连接方式,都需要提供以下信息:
  • Hive服务的地址和端口号
  • 数据库用户名和密码(如果需要身份验证)
  • 数据库名称和其他必要的连接参数
    请注意,连接Hive时需要考虑安全性和权限设置。确保只向受信任的客户端开放连接,并使用强密码来保护你的数据库。此外,定期更新和修补你的Hive系统和相关组件也是至关重要的,以防止安全漏洞和其他问题。
    总结起来,Hive数据库的端口和连接方式是使用该系统的重要方面。通过了解如何修改端口号以及如何使用不同的连接方式连接到Hive,你可以更好地满足你的需求并提高数据处理和分析的效率。同时,确保遵循最佳的安全实践,保护你的数据免受未经授权的访问和恶意攻击。

相关文章推荐

发表评论